amount measure; quantity.
bite to cut with the teeth.
burn to be on fire.
campfire an outdoor fire used for cooking or warmth while camping.
cash money in the form of bills and coins.
check to look at something in order to make sure that it is right or correct.
crop plants grown on a farm.
fetch to go somewhere, pick up something, and bring it back.
flat1 having a surface that does not slant up or down. If a roof is flat, it is not higher at one end than the other; level.
further comparative of far; at or to a greater distance.
neighbor a person who lives close to someone else.
pilgrim a person who takes a trip to a holy place for a religious purpose.
shed2 to take off or drop something that covers or grows.
splendid beautiful or grand; making a strong impression.
wheel a round thing that turns in circles and allows cars, trucks, bicycles, and other things to move.
